How the Poll Was Conducted

The Times Poll contacted 1,790 people citywide by telephone June 20-28. Phone numbers were chosen from a list of all exchanges in Los Angeles. Random-digit dialing techniques were used so that listed and unlisted numbers could be contacted. The entire sample was weighted slightly to conform with census figures for sex, race, age, education, registration and area of the city. The margin of sampling error for the entire city and for registered voters is plus or minus 3 percentage points. For certain subgroups the error margin may be somewhat higher. Poll results also can be affected by factors such as question wording and the order in which questions are presented. Interviews were conducted in English and Spanish.
